Thermodynamics studies on the adsorption of phenol from aqueous solution by coffee husk activated carbon

Activated carbons (ACs) obtained from coffee husk by KOH activation at 650 (ACK-650) and 750oC (ACK-750), were used as an adsorbent for the adsorption of phenol aqueous solution. The ACs was characterized SEM, EDX, BET, Boehm titration techniques. experimental equilibrium data analyzed eight isotherm models, which are four two-parameter equations (Langmuir, Freundlich, Elovich, Temkin) three-parameter (Redlich-Peterson, Sips, Radke-Prausnitz, Toth). results reveal that in general, isotherms can provide better prediction than isotherms. best fit ACK-650 sample is Sips isotherm, while ACK-750 Redlich–Peterson isotherm. Isosteric heat thermodynamic parameters ?Go, ?Ho, ?So determined, showed exothermic physical nature. A scale-up a batch system designed 2 to 10 L with initial concentration 100 mg L-1.
